Common rejection reasons

These are the most frequent reasons consulates refuse short-stay visa applications in general — review them before you submit.

  • !Insufficient financial proof: low bank balance, irregular deposits, or unexplained large transfers in the last 3 months of statements.
  • !Weak ties to your home country: no stable employment, no property, no family dependents the consulate can verify.
  • !Prior overstay or visa violation in any country, even years ago — this stays on record and is a serious red flag.
  • !Document inconsistencies: mismatched names, dates, or amounts between the application form, payslips, and bank statements.
  • !Suspicious travel pattern: prior visa-free trips with no return stamps, or itineraries that do not match the stated purpose.
  • !Unclear travel purpose: vague itinerary, no hotel bookings, or invitations from unverifiable hosts.

Frequently asked questions

Do Türkiye citizens need a visa to enter Indonesia?
Yes — but the visa is issued on arrival. Carry your return ticket, hotel reservation and the visa fee in cash when you land in Indonesia.
